Start with one serving of quick oats, I use 1/3 cup of Quaker. Grind it up so it's a fine powder:
Add in your choice of protein powder, I love Elite Whey Protein, the flavours are awesome! For these pancakes I used Buttercream Toffee.

I also added in my favourite powdered peanut butter. PB2 is amazing, it's all natural and has 1/2 the calories and fat of regular peanut butter, with close to the same flavour. It's not Kraft, but it's clean :) 
 I threw in one serving of PB2 which is 2tbsp's. Mix in 1/2 tsp of baking powder for a bit of FLUFF!

Add in your liquid, you can use water, regular milk, soy, whatever you like. My favourite is vanilla almond milk. With only 45 calories in a cup, and a great taste, you can't go wrong. Plus it's lactose free, so if you don't do well with cow's milk this is a perfect alternative.
 I added about 3/4 cup of almond, but go by consistency. It should be thick, and somewhat like regular pancake batter.

Throw that batter on your grill and voila! I used 1tsp of butter to grease my pan, but if you have a non stick pan or non stick cooking spray, that's just as good.

I got 4 pancakes out of the batch, and it contained 500 calories and 42 grams of protein.
